site stats

Dangling reference example

WebDangling References. If Automatic Garbage Collection is turned off for a heap variable and the variable is destroyed using PTR_FREE or OBJ_DESTROY, any remaining pointer variables or object references that still refer to it are "dangling references." Unlike lower level languages such as C, dereferencing a dangling reference will not crash or ... WebThe IS DANGLING clause helps identify a dangling reference and update it with a suitable reference. Let us look at the example of Anne Nicole. After the CUSTOMER_TYPE record for Anne Nicole has been deleted, the …

Dangling pointer - Wikipedia

WebJan 17, 2024 · Recognizing dangling modifiers In a correct sentence, the subject (or doer) that is modified should immediately follow the comma after the modifier. In the example … WebDangling reference arise during object destruction, when an object that has an incoming reference is deleted or deallocated, without modifying the value of the pointer, so that … stay tuned imdb https://fredstinson.com

Dangling Pointer in C - The Crazy Programmer

WebFor example:;Destroy the heap variable. PTR_FREE, A ;Try to print again. PRINT, A, *A. IDL prints: % Invalid pointer: A. % Execution halted at: $MAIN$ There are several … WebJan 1, 2024 · Enjoy the following examples of dangling modifiers. Each example starts with an incorrect sentence and ends with a solution. By the time we’re done, you’ll be a better writer and editor. Dangling modifiers … WebAlthough references, once initialized, always refer to valid objects or functions, it is possible to create a program where the lifetime of the referred-to object ends, but the reference … stay tuned end credits

Dangling modifiers (practice) Khan Academy

Category:Dangling else - Wikipedia

Tags:Dangling reference example

Dangling reference example

What is dangling reference? - Quora

WebDangling Reference: Example 4 pointer to variable from outside its scope { int *x; {int y; x = &y; // point 1} // point 2} At point 1, the value of x is the address of the local variable y At point 2, y is no longer accessible and its memory is reclaimed (de-allocated) but x still points to the memory previously associated with y Note. WebSep 12, 2024 · The object being returned by reference must exist after the function returns. Using return by reference has one major caveat: the programmer must be sure that the object being referenced outlives the function returning the reference. Otherwise, the reference being returned will be left dangling (referencing an object that has been …

Dangling reference example

Did you know?

WebOct 27, 2011 · Yes there is an issue with that code. You are returning a reference to a local variable. In the simple example you wrote - it will semm to work - but the result should be considered 'undefined'. Returning a pointer to or a reference to a local variable is a no-no. Last edited on Oct 18, 2011 at 2:25am. Oct 18, 2011 at 3:00am. WebJun 20, 2024 · A dangling modifier is a word or phrase (often a participle or participial phrase) that doesn't actually modify the word it's intended to modify. In some cases, a …

WebA dangling modifier is a word or phrase that modifies a word not clearly stated in the sentence. A modifier describes, clarifies, or gives more detail about a concept. Having … WebMar 5, 2024 · What is dangling reference in storage allocation explain with an example? 3. 25. A dangling reference is a reference to an object that no longer exists. Garbage is …

WebDangling references. If a non-reference entity is captured by reference, implicitly or explicitly, and the function call operator or a specialization of the function call operator template of the closure object is invoked after the entity's lifetime has ended, undefined behavior occurs. ... This example shows how to pass a lambda to a generic ... WebDangling pointer in C. In the program, we should not use the dangling pointer. It can be the cause of memory faults. Here I am mentioning few forms of the dangling pointer, I think you should know. 1. If a pointer points to an address that not belongs to your process but knows by the OS, then this type of pointer is a dangling pointer.

WebThe dangling else is a problem in programming of parser generators in which an optional else clause in an if–then(–else) statement results in nested conditionals being ambiguous. Formally, the reference context-free grammar of the language is ambiguous, meaning there is more than one correct parse tree.. In many programming languages one may write …

Web2. Turn the dangling element into a clause with its own subject. In other words, a dangling element should refer or “stick to” the nearest subject, and that subject in turn should be … stay tuned for further updatesWebWhen pushing or pulling to a 2.0 registry, the push or pull command output includes the image digest. You can pull using a digest value. You can also reference by digest in create, run, and rmi commands, as well as the FROM image reference in a Dockerfile.. Filtering (--filter) The filtering flag (-f or --filter) format is of “key=value”.If there is more than one filter, … stay tuned similar phrasesWebNov 15, 2024 · We see 2 Examples which both have dangling references: Example A: int main () { cout << getref () << '\n'; cout << "- reached end" << std::endl; return 0; } In Example A I get a compiler warning and the expected Segfault on reading the dangling reference. In Example B I get neither the warning nor the Segfault and returns the … stay tuned for my next episodeWebSep 1, 2024 · In short, you return reference to local variable of function. When function returns, local variable ceases to exist, and the returned reference becomes dangling: it does not reference a valid variable. Solution: return value, not reference, or allocate … stay tuned movie clipsWebJan 1, 2008 · I think there were a few examples of const reference member variables above, for the purpose to test virtual dispatch. That brought me to another question. It seems that lifetime extension of an oblect assignment to constant reference works only within a scope where constant reference is declared. stay tuned bookWebJan 1, 2024 · Example 2 with a Participle Phrase. “Having missed school for a week, a written doctor’s note was needed.”. The written doctor’s note hasn’t missed any school — but someone has. So, once we add that … stay tuned in or onWebDangling Reference Syntax The following diagram uses an example to explain the variables in the syntax: SELECT product_id, log_datetime FROM pet_care_log_obj_table WHERE product_id is DANGLING; The … stay tuned for our upcoming posts